**TICKET-4182: Signature check failing on crash-report uploads**

Since last night's deploy, the Fennick mobile crash-report pipeline rejects every bundle with "signature mismatch." Symbol uploads are blocked, so we're blind on the 3.9.1 crashes. Root cause: the ingest worker still pins the pre-rotation verifier. Fix is staged; release manager sign-off needed before we push. For verification, the current uploader signing key is as follows.

signing key of bagap-yawep = bky13_TbfT6ZMUoGJo2

# Env Vars: Planner Regression Mitigation

After the query planner regression in Corvid DB 9.3, Fernwell's release builds must pin the legacy planner until the patched build ships. Set `CORVID_PLANNER_MODE=legacy` in the release env file and confirm it with the preflight check before tagging. The planner override endpoint requires authentication, so the release env file also needs the planner override token on the next line.

env line for kahof-fajeg: ARCHIVE_KEY3=397

MEMO — Archive Intake, Larchfield Repository

Twelve film reels from the Dennow Pictures collection arrive Thursday morning via courier. Reels are in climate cases; move them straight to the cold store, do not open cases on the dock. Intake staff should log case numbers against the manifest and note any damage before signing. For the hand-over itself, the courier will expect the following instruction to be carried out.

handover note for yagef-bagep: the drudor pelius courier leaves the kasdor zorvan norir ledger at gate 8016 under passcode 755406